Child Meniscus Tear – Does It Always Need Surgery? A meniscus tear in a child or young athlete needs careful evaluation because the meniscus is important for protecting the knee and preventing future joint problems. Does every meniscus tear need surgery? Not necessarily. The treatment depends on the type and location of the tear, symptoms, age, activity level, and whether the knee is locking or unstable. Surgery may be considered when there is: • A displaced or unstable tear • Repeated knee locking or catching • Persistent pain or swelling despite appropriate treatment • A tear that is unlikely to heal on its own • An associated ACL or other ligament injury Whenever possible, my aim is to preserve and repair the meniscus rather than remove it, particularly in children and young athletes. Meniscus preservation can be important for the long-term health of the knee. If your child has knee pain or has been diagnosed with a meniscus tear on MRI, don’t assume surgery is automatically required. A clinical examination and review of the MRI are important before deciding the treatment.
